Prime Minister receives courtesy call from Indian High Commissioner

Prime Minister, the Hon. (R’etd) Brigadier Mark Phillips, this morning, received a courtesy call from High Commissioner of India to Guyana, His Excellency, Dr. K. J. Srinivasa, at the Office of the Prime Minister, Colgrain House, Camp Street.

During the meeting, the Prime Minister and the High Commissioner discussed areas of collaboration between the two countries, including the upgrading of major infrastructure in Guyana such as roads, hospitals and river transport.

The Prime Minister disclosed that he was heartened to have received the High Commissioner and is eager for the projects discussed to come to fruition.

Meanwhile, Dr. Srinivasa briefed the Prime Minister on India’s competency in the areas such as technology, solar energy and health care.

At the close of the meeting, the High Commissioner presented Prime Minister Phillips with a token of appreciation.

Counsellor, Indian High Commission, Mr. Vijayakumar K. accompanied the High Commissioner to the meeting.
